Craftsman House. Exposed rafter tails, which are the beams that stick out of the house and can be seen under the eaves. Its porches are either full or partial width, with tapered columns or pedestals that extend to the ground level. The craftsman house, also known as the american craftsman, is an architectural style that originated from the american arts and crafts movement towards the end of the 19th century.
